M-Tech BT-05 is a common, budget-friendly Bluetooth 5.0 USB dongle often used to add wireless connectivity to older PCs or laptops. While these devices are typically "plug-and-play" on modern systems, the "story" of the driver usually involves a few specific hurdles. | Problem | Likely Cause | Fix | |---------|--------------|-----| | Dongle not detected | Faulty USB port or dead unit | Test on another PC. If nothing appears in Device Manager, it’s hardware failure. | | Driver installs but no Bluetooth icon | Conflicting driver from another Bluetooth device | Disable internal Bluetooth in BIOS/Device Manager. | | Audio stuttering / cuts out | USB 3.0 interference | Use a USB 2.0 extension cable or port on the front panel. | | Can’t pair a Bluetooth 4.0 device (e.g., Xbox controller) | Old CSR driver stack | Update to CSR Harmony or use Windows native driver (remove custom stack). | | “Driver is unavailable” on Windows 11 | Windows Update block on unsigned drivers | Boot into Disable Driver Signature Enforcement and install the legacy CSR driver. | Data Rate: Up to 3Mbps (EDR support)
